Transaction 6f5af820db236aad37ecf4dab150ba32107ebaa39c28d3a3640924faaf920c32

2 Input
2 Outputs
  • 6f5af820db236aad37ecf4dab150ba32107ebaa39c28d3a3640924faaf920c32:0
  • value  220000
    address  35omQNa4NhMacZcHcwpGbGXpuHE4mYWqcG
  • 6f5af820db236aad37ecf4dab150ba32107ebaa39c28d3a3640924faaf920c32:1
  • value  1069436
    address  3H9pqqmafQGrNJapPDnE77sPZQgtSNpyd9